Magoye vs Sukhumi Climate & Distance Between

Georgia flag
  • The distance between Magoye, Zambia and Sukhumi, Georgia is approximately 6,722 km or 4,177 mi.
  • To reach Magoye in this distance one would set out from Sukhumi bearing 194.9° or SSW and follow the great circles arc to approach Magoye bearing 191.3° or SSW .
  • Magoye has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a) whereas Sukhumi has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Magoye is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ome whereas Sukhumi is in or near the boreal rain for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 6.5 °C (11.6°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 8.7 °C (15.7°F) less in Magoye.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 652.7 mm (25.7 in) less which is equivalent to 652.7 l/m² (16.02 US gal/ft²) or 6,527,000 l/ha (697,780 US gal/ac) less. About 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 23.6° higher in Magoye than in Sukhumi.
